A Place of Reflection: Maria Moeder van de Kerk
Maria Moeder van de Kerk, located in Kolderbos, Genk, Belgium, stands as an essential center for community and spirituality.
Founded in the late 20th century, this church was established to serve the growing population of the area, reflecting the importance of faith in local society. Its modern architecture, characterized by unique design elements, integrates seamlessly into the landscape, emphasizing minimalism and functionality.
